Least Common Multiple of 84273 and 84289 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 84273 and 84289,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(84273,84289) = 1
LCM(84273,84289) = ( 84273 × 84289) / 1
LCM(84273,84289) = 7103286897 / 1
LCM(84273,84289) = 7103286897
